    March 3, 2017 - Cork crumbled when I tried to remove it, so I decanted this through a wire strainer. This shows very mature and resolved; a bottle last fall was corked but otherwise seemed younger. Cedar and smokey gravel and mint, red currant fruit, light in weight, plenty of acid. Pretty but starting to fade. I wonder if bottles with better corks would show younger.

    September 30, 2016 - Served blind. I was guessing an 20+ year old Napa Cab. Close but not quite. Beautiful classic Cali Cab nose with dried plum, toasty oak, bell pepper and cigar ash. On the palate this is polished with mature fruit that still has plenty of life and even gains intensity with air. Tannins are gentle and resolved. Terrific and classic.

    February 26, 2014 - Served to me blind and I immediately thought it from Bordeaux, possibly 1989 or 1990. Dense black fruit with some very good licorice, black pepper and dried herb from start to finish, with some elegant, earthy notes. Very good acidity and balance throughout with good mid-weight.

    September 7, 2013 - Upon opening this was beautiful, with red and black stone fruit, herbs de provence, and dusty notes. It fell apart somewhat quickly though, increasingly showing just leather and fruit-roll flavors. Still, what a treat to drink! Might be several years past peak.
